Plan Your Wiring Path Effectively

Start by inspecting your deck’s layout, looking for existing gaps, joints, or edges where low-voltage wiring can be routed. Use a tape measure and chalk to mark a clean path that follows either the railing, fascia, or underneath the deck joists. I once applied this method by temporarily taping electrical conduit along the underside of my deck’s outer rim, avoiding any drilling, and it worked seamlessly, leaving no scars or visible damage.

Use Surface-Mounted Conduits for Wires

Install low-profile surface conduits or raceways along the marked path. Once secured with outdoor-rated adhesive clips or screws into existing structures, these conduits hide wiring effectively. During my project, I clipped conduit along the fascia, which kept the wiring neat and protected from weather and foot traffic. Choose translucent or color-matched conduits to blend with your deck’s finish.

Employ Existing Gaps and Joints

Leverage natural gaps between deck boards or along the perimeter to run wires without drilling. For example, I routed wires into the gap between two decking boards, then concealed them with a decorative cover that matched my deck’s color. This method is especially useful when adding string lights or small fixtures, as it keeps wiring discreet and avoids permanent alteration of the deck surface.

Use Low-Voltage LED Lighting for Simplicity

Opt for low-voltage LED fixtures that require minimal wiring and can be powered by small transformers. I installed recessed LED puck lights into the underside of my deck’s overhang, connecting them through surface conduit. This setup provided ample illumination, and since the wiring was surface-mounted using clips, I avoided drilling large holes in my composite deck boards.

Secure Wires Safely and Neatly

Secure all wiring with outdoor-rated clips, ties, or conduits, ensuring they’re taut and away from foot traffic or moving parts. I used plastic zip ties to bundle wires neatly along the surface, preventing sagging or damage. Remember, keeping wires tidy not only looks better but also prolongs their lifespan and safety.

Test Before Finalizing

Once your wiring is in place, connect the fixtures and test the system thoroughly. Check for proper operation, and ensure wires are securely fastened, with no loose ends or exposed conductors. I recommend doing this step before covering or concealing the wiring fully, so you can troubleshoot easily if needed.

Tools That Keep Your Decks in Perfect Shape

Maintaining your outdoor space requires the right equipment. I swear by a high-quality cordless oscillating multi-tool, like the Fein MultiMaster, for its versatility in cleaning and minor repairs. Its precision blade makes it ideal for removing loose caulking, sanding small areas, or detailing tight spots — tasks that larger tools struggle with. For deeper cleaning, I use a soft-bristle deck brush coupled with a telescoping pole to reach between boards without damaging the surface, especially on composite decking where abrasive tools could cause scratches.

Another indispensable gadget is a moisture meter. Regularly checking the moisture content of your wood components can prevent rot and warping. I personally rely on a pin-type meter for accuracy, particularly when inspecting stair stringers or post footings beneath the surface. Early detection of moisture build-up saves a lot of headaches down the line.

When it comes to sealing or applying finishes, I recommend a quality sprayer like the Wagner Control Pro 170, which provides even coverage with minimal effort. Consistent application reduces the risk of water infiltration and extends the life of your decking materials. For composite surfaces, a gentle wash with a soft brush and a mild cleaner like diluted soap or specially formulated composite deck cleaner is sufficient — aggressive pressure washing may do more harm than good.

To keep your tools functioning optimally, I always use a silicone spray lubricant on rotating parts and blades, ensuring smooth operation and prolonging their lifespan. Regular maintenance of your tools not only guarantees safety but also saves money on replacements.
